How much does it cost to rent an apartment in North Hollywood?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
North Hollywood Studio Apartments | $2,013 | $1,295 | $4,895 |
North Hollywood 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,475 | $926 | $7,135 |
North Hollywood 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,218 | $1,700 | $10,000+ |
North Hollywood 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,881 | $2,775 | $8,980 |
North Hollywood 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,084 | $3,500 | $10,000+ |
